Digital Television Transition and Public Safety Act of 2005 The Digital Television Transition and Public Safety Act of 2005 established a statutory deadline for the United States' transition from analog to digital terrestrial television broadcasting and authorized measures to repurpose electromagnetic radio spectrum for public safety and wireless broadband uses. It created a converter box subsidy program administered by the National Telecommunications and Information Administration and set auction rules administered by the Federal Communications Commission for reallocated spectrum. Key statutory provisions included setting a final deadline for full-power broadcasters to cease analog transmissions, creation of a $1.5 billion converter box coupon program, directives to the Federal Communications Commission to hold incentive auctions and allocate reclaimed spectrum, and establishment of a process for compensating broadcasters for low-power operations and public television obligations. The Act amended provisions in the Communications Act of 1934 and mandated coordination with entities such as the National Institute of Standards and Technology for technical standards and with the United States Government Accountability Office for program oversight.
The converter box coupon program issued up to two $40 coupons per household to subsidize digital-to-analog converter boxes, managed by the National Telecommunications and Information Administration and implemented via contractors with ties to firms that had provided services to agencies such as the General Services Administration. A central policy aim was reallocating the 700 MHz band to support public safety broadband and commercial auction proceeds to fund the coupon program.
